Cheyney Thompson continues to play by his own rules in his current solo exhibition with Andrew Kreps Gallery. Thompson explores the commericial aspect of an exhibition by laying out the function and structure of an art gallery as a virtual market in his press release. Vibrant but conventional abstract paintings are produced as the means to an end.
Sometimes Some Pictures Somewhere is on view through June 23rd at Andrew Kreps Gallery, 525 West 22nd Street, New York. Photo and text Juliana Balestin
